Brent has been involved in the financial services industry since 1992, has been an advisor since 1994, and served as a trust officer for 10 years. Prior to joining Savant, he was vice president and wealth management consultant for a large bank where he was responsible for financial planning and new business development in the $2.5 billion trust department, specializing in high net worth individuals. He is experienced in asset management, personal trusts, corporate retirement plans, banking, and the wealth management planning process. Brent earned a bachelor of arts degree in economics from the University of Iowa. He is a Certified Trust and Financial Advisor (CTFA), a C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ER™ professional, an Accredited Investment Fiduciary® (AIF®), and a Chartered Retirement Plans Specialist℠ (CRPS®). Brent received extensive training at the Cannon Financial Instituteâs Trust School at the University of Notre Dame and is a member of the National Association of Personal Financial Advisors (NAPFA). Brent is a member of the Greater Madison Chamber of Commerce and the Middleton Chamber of Commerce, and he serves on the public works committee for the Town of Verona (WI). Brent is routinely interviewed by local television stations for his financial expertise and has been quoted by Yahoo! Finance, Financial Advisor magazine, and Fox Business, among others. Sarah is a founding member of Cents of Self, an initiative that inspires, informs, and empowers women to pursue their best financial futures. She has been involved in the financial services industry since 2015. Prior to joining Savant, Sarah worked for a forensic and litigation consulting group, specializing in data analytics, specifically on fraud investigations and mortgage-backed securities cases. Sarah earned a bachelor of science degree in finance from the University of Illinois, where she graduated as a top 10 student in the College of Business and a top 100 student in the university. She is a C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ER™ professional, a Chartered Retirement Plans Specialist℠ (CRPS®), and an Accredited Behavioral Finance Professional℠ (ABFP℠). Sarah is a member of the Junior League of Madison and serves on the board of the Madison Estate Council.
